One of the best games around the B1G going into Week 3 is Michigan State-Miami.

The Spartans have started their season out 2-0 with convincing wins over Northwestern and Youngtown State, while Miami struggled out of the gate by getting creamed by Alabama. They followed that loss up by barely squeaking by Appalachian State (25-23).

Miami is now ranked No. 24 in the country and because of that, they’re favored in this matchup.

According to ESPN’s FPI, MSU has just a 34.3% chance of winning against the Hurricanes.

That seems to be a bit too low, based on what has transpired thus far. The Spartans have blown the doors off their opposition in both games while Miami has struggled mightily in theirs. Granted, Miami did have to play Alabama in their opening game but they haven’t looked nearly as sharp as MSU has.

Miami is 4-0 all time against the Spartans.

We’ll have to see if the FPI is correct when the 2 teams kickoff at Noon ET this Saturday on ABC.
